Mont-sur-Marchienne (French pronunciation: [mɔ̃ syʁ maʁʃjɛn]; Walloon: Mont-dzeu-Mårciene) is a town of Wallonia and a district of the municipality of Charleroi, located in the province of Hainaut, Belgium.
It was a municipality of its own before the merger of the municipalities in 1977.
